Sick Retic...
To make a long story short...A few days ago, I was feeding our Reticulated Python and noticed she had some nasty sores on her lower jaw. Once she was done eating I gently grabbed her and inspected her mouth. It appeared to me that she had a good case of mouth rot. I immediately made an appointment w/ my herp vet and he saw her this past Friday. He agreed it looked to be a bacterial infection, but not mouth rot. He prescribed 6 injections of Amakacin w/ 3 day intervals. Let me tell you...Giving a 6+ foot constrictor injections is no fun! I just really hope we get this infection nipped in the butt. We still have no idea where it came from.

Thanks guys.
My wife and I gave her the first shot last night. Once i got the syringe into the snake, she began to struggle and my wife could not hold her still. I got the meds in, be she bent the needle in the process. Her next shot is Wednesday...I'm going to have one of my guy friends hold her from now on. This snake is just too strong for her to hold still. It was all I could do to hold her while the vet showed me how to administer her first shot.
I feel bad. This is a very intelligent snake and she now seems to know what is coming as soon as I open her cage. Four more times....-Jordan
